The Timberland Company (TBL)
The Company designs, develops, engineers, markets and distributes premium quality footwear, apparel and accessories products for men, women and children.

I have owned a pair of Timbs steel-toe workboots for almost six years, and they have held up to everthing I have thrown at them. They cost me $90 at Safety Solutions - a great company that I hope one day goes public; they could be the Cabela's of Personal Protecitve Equipment, but that's beside the point. Recently I saw some Timberland jackets on sale for about $90. I read some customer reviews of these jackets that were very negative. In addition to the recent introduction of poor quality products, the Timberland brand is beginning to lose it's fasion cachet. Also, production costs are squeezing margins. This stock is going nowhere unless this company can focus on what it does best - making good shoes - or come up with some sexy products for which the urban fasionistas will pay top dollar.
